rep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
#define __GNUC__ = 2.1
2016-10-15
g
r
ischka
#def
i
n
e __GNUC__
=
2
.
1
commit
|
commitdiff
|
tree
2016-10-15
gris
c
hka
tccgen/tccelf:
move code from libtcc
.
c
commit
|
commitdiff
|
tree
2016-10-13
gr
i
schka
t
c
cge
n
: 32bi
t
s: f
i
x PTR +/-
long long
commit
|
commitdiff
|
tree
2016-10-09
gr
i
schka
t
c
c
p
p : "tcc -E -P" : su
p
p
ress emp
t
y
l
ines
commit
|
commitdiff
|
tree
2016-10-05
grisch
k
a
Misc
.
fixes
commit
|
commitdiff
|
tree
2016-10-04
grischka
tc
c
g
e
n: arm/i3
8
6: save_reg_upstack
commit
|
commitdiff
|
tree
2016-10-04
grischka
tccpp: no
cach
e
for i
n
clude
if #elif seen
commit
|
commitdiff
|
tree
2016-10-03
g
r
i
schka
Alternative fi
x
for "Incorrect f
u
nction call
c
ode on
.
.
.
commit
|
commitdiff
|
tree
2016-10-03
grischka
configure: fix t
c
c_
l
d
dir, cpu
commit
|
commitdiff
|
tree
2016-10-01
grischka
tccgen: fi
x
l
o
ng long -
>
c
h
ar/short c
a
st
commit
|
commitdiff
|
tree
2016-10-01
grischka
win32/64:
m
sys2 support
commit
|
commitdiff
|
tree
2016-10-01
g
r
i
s
c
h
ka
tcce
l
f
:
allow m
u
lt
i
pl
e
d
ecla
r
a
t
ion of bss/common symbols
commit
|
commitdiff
|
tree
2016-10-01
grischka
tccpp: parse_line_comment: fix possib
l
e b
u
ffer overrun
commit
|
commitdiff
|
tree
2016-10-01
g
r
ischka
tccpp: allo
w
"0x1e+1
"
in asm
commit
|
commitdiff
|
tree
2016-10-01
g
risc
h
ka
tccpp: token ##
pas
t
i
n
g
:
preserve parts
if pasting
.
.
.
commit
|
commitdiff
|
tree
2016-10-01
gr
i
schka
Revert "-fnormalize-inc-dirs"
commit
|
commitdiff
|
tree
2016-10-01
grisch
k
a
t
cc -E: ad
d
one s
p
ace in cases: tiny sol
u
tion
commit
|
commitdiff
|
tree
2016-10-01
grischka
build: restore out-of-tree
s
upport
commit
|
commitdiff
|
tree
2016-10-01
grisch
k
a
build
:
reve
r
t
M
ake
f
iles to 0
.
9
.
26 state (mostly)
commit
|
commitdiff
|
tree
2016-10-01
gr
i
sch
k
a
test/pp: cleanu
p
commit
|
commitdiff
|
tree
2016-10-01
g
rischka
libtcc: reimpl
e
m
e
nt option -Wl,[-no]-whöle-archive
commit
|
commitdiff
|
tree
2016-10-01
gr
i
s
c
hka
libtcc: -Wl,
.
.
.
increm
e
n
tal pa
r
s
i
ng
commit
|
commitdiff
|
tree
2016-10-01
gri
s
c
h
ka
R
e
vert "output all
se
c
tions if we
produce
an exe
c
utable
.
.
.
commit
|
commitdiff
|
tree
2016-10-01
grisch
k
a
Revert part
of "fix installa
t
ion amd
bchec
k
fo
r
Windows"
commit
|
commitdiff
|
tree
2016-10-01
grischka
lib
t
cc: filetyp
e
cl
e
anup
commit
|
commitdiff
|
tree
2016-10-01
gr
i
s
c
hka
Remove mi
s
c
.
file
s
commit
|
commitdiff
|
tree
2016-10-01
gri
s
c
h
ka
tccpp: cleanup
commit
|
commitdiff
|
tree
2016-10-01
gr
i
schka
libtcc: c
l
e
anup @listfi
l
e
commit
|
commitdiff
|
tree
2016-10-01
grischk
a
l
i
btcc: cleanu
p
-x<fil
e
type> swi
t
c
h
c
o
de
commit
|
commitdiff
|
tree
2016-10-01
g
r
ischka
Revert "ab
i
lity to comp
i
le
multipl
e
*
.
c fil
e
s with
.
.
.
commit
|
commitdiff
|
tree
2016-10-01
g
r
ischka
tcc
p
p: #pragma
o
nce: make it work
commit
|
commitdiff
|
tree
2016-10-01
grischka
tccpp: restore -D symbols for mu
l
tiple source
s
commit
|
commitdiff
|
tree
2016-10-01
grischka
Revert "--
w
hol
e
-a
r
c
h
ive
su
p
port"
commit
|
commitdiff
|
tree
2016-07-10
gris
c
hka
win64: fix va_
a
rg
commit
|
commitdiff
|
tree
2016-05-25
gri
s
c
h
k
a
tccgen
:
g
en_assign_cast()
:
cannot cast struct
t
o scala
r
commit
|
commitdiff
|
tree
2016-05-25
g
r
isch
k
a
R
edo "fix
l
i
ne number in
m
acro
r
edefined me
s
sage"
commit
|
commitdiff
|
tree
2016-05-12
grischka
tcc -E -
P
10 : output all num
b
ers as
d
ecimals
commit
|
commitdiff
|
tree
2016-05-06
g
rischka
tccgen: scopes
l
evels for local symbols (update 2)
commit
|
commitdiff
|
tree
2016-05-05
grischka
tccgen: scope
s
l
e
vels for
l
oca
l
s
y
mbols
(update
1)
commit
|
commitdiff
|
tree
2016-05-05
grisc
h
k
a
t
c
cpp
:
c
leanup options -dD -dM, re
m
ove -C
commit
|
commitdiff
|
tree
2016-05-05
gr
i
schka
tccgen: sc
o
pe levels for local symbols
commit
|
commitdiff
|
tree
2016-04-29
gris
c
h
k
a
tccpp:
macro su
b
st fix
commit
|
commitdiff
|
tree
2015-11-20
grischka
tc
c
pp
:
allow
.
.
i
n
tok
e
n s
t
ream
commit
|
commitdiff
|
tree
2015-11-20
gr
i
schka
tccpp: cleanup #include_
n
ext
commit
|
commitdiff
|
tree
2015-11-20
grischka
tccge
n
:
asm_labe
l
cleanup
commit
|
commitdiff
|
tree
2015-05-09
grischka
tccpp: fix issues, add
t
ests
commit
|
commitdiff
|
tree
2015-04-23
gri
s
chka
tccpp: alter
n
at
i
ve
#pragma
p
ush/pop_mac
r
o
commit
|
commitdiff
|
tree
2015-04-23
grischk
a
Revert "* and
#pr
a
gma pop_macro
(
"macro
_
name")"
commit
|
commitdiff
|
tree
2014-09-23
grischka
tccg
e
n: use lvalue
as resul
t
fro
m
bitfield assignme
n
t
commit
|
commitdiff
|
tree
2014-08-01
grischka
tcc
g
en
:
nocod
e
_want
e
d: d
o
not output
c
onstan
t
s
commit
|
commitdiff
|
tree
2014-08-01
grisch
k
a
win64: fix res
o
u
rc
e
file support
commit
|
commitdiff
|
tree
2014-06-25
grisc
h
ka
w
i
n64: try to fix
linkage
commit
|
commitdiff
|
tree
2014-05-08
g
rischka
win64: try
t
o
fix linkag
e
commit
|
commitdiff
|
tree
2014-05-06
grischka
Re
v
ert "update static void parse_number()"
commit
|
commitdiff
|
tree
2014-05-01
g
r
i
s
chka
Atten
t
i
o
n: never use hard t
a
bs ot
h
e
r
than 8 (eight
.
.
.
commit
|
commitdiff
|
tree
2014-04-17
grischka
tccpe: a
d
just for ne
w
'hidd
e
n' s
y
mbols
feature
commit
|
commitdiff
|
tree
2014-04-13
gris
c
hka
tccpe:
s
peed up
.
de
f
f
ile loa
d
i
ng
commit
|
commitdiff
|
tree
2014-04-07
gr
i
schka
te
s
ts2: cleanup
commit
|
commitdiff
|
tree
2014-04-07
g
rischka
win32: libtcc1
.
a
n
eeds to be built
with tc
c
commit
|
commitdiff
|
tree
2014-04-06
g
r
ischka
win32: w
a
rn
p
e
ople about using undeclared WINAP
I
functions
commit
|
commitdiff
|
tree
2014-04-04
grisc
h
ka
t
c
c
gen: x86_64: fix garb
a
g
e
in the SValue upper bits
commit
|
commitdiff
|
tree
2014-03-29
grisch
k
a
tccpp: re
o
rder some
tokens
commit
|
commitdiff
|
tree
2014-01-21
grischka
tc
c
test: add back tes
t
X
b
(self compile wit
h
-b)
commit
|
commitdiff
|
tree
2014-01-07
grischka
be stricter with
aliasing
commit
|
commitdiff
|
tree
2014-01-06
grisc
h
ka
misc
.
fixes
commit
|
commitdiff
|
tree
2014-01-06
gr
i
s
chka
tc
c
pe: cleanup "
i
m
por
t
s pe
r
ord
i
nal"
commit
|
commitdiff
|
tree
2014-01-06
grischka
i386: use __fixdfd
i
instea
d
of __tcc_cv
t
_f
t
ol
commit
|
commitdiff
|
tree
2013-12-16
gri
s
chka
F
ix "Add support for struct > 4B returned via reg
i
ste
r
s
"
commit
|
commitdiff
|
tree
2013-09-10
gris
c
hka
win32:
f
ix
l
i
btcc sup
p
ort
commit
|
commitdiff
|
tree
2013-08-28
grischka
i386
-
gen: preserve fp co
n
t
rol word in
gen_cvt_ftoi
commit
|
commitdiff
|
tree
2013-07-24
grischka
tccgen: fix crash wi
t
h undeclared
str
u
ct
commit
|
commitdiff
|
tree
2013-05-05
gr
i
s
chka
Reli
c
e
n
sing TinyCC
commit
|
commitdiff
|
tree
2013-04-29
grischk
a
avoid "decl aft
e
r statement
"
please
commit
|
commitdiff
|
tree
2013-02-14
grischka
confi
g
u
re
:
de
t
ect AR
M
variant
s
commit
|
commitdiff
|
tree
2013-02-14
grischka
conf
i
gure: pass CONFIG_xxxDIR/PATH options
via commandline
commit
|
commitdiff
|
tree
2013-02-14
grischka
config
u
r
e: clean
u
p
commit
|
commitdiff
|
tree
2013-02-12
g
r
i
schka
l
i
btcc: new LIBTCCAPI tcc_s
e
t_opt
i
ons(TCCState*
,
const
.
.
.
commit
|
commitdiff
|
tree
2013-02-10
grisc
h
k
a
tcc --help: update option
summary
commit
|
commitdiff
|
tree
2013-02-09
grischka
tc
c
-vv/--print-searc
h
-dir
s
: print more info
commit
|
commitdiff
|
tree
2013-02-08
g
rischka
tcc
.
h:
d
ec
l
a
r
e CValue
.
tab[LDOUBLE_S
I
ZE
/
4]
commit
|
commitdiff
|
tree
2013-02-06
g
r
ischka
lib/Mak
e
file: use
C
C
, add
bcheck to l
i
btc
c
1
.
a
commit
|
commitdiff
|
tree
2013-02-05
gris
c
h
k
a
tccelf
:
fix
d
ebug section relocat
i
on
commit
|
commitdiff
|
tree
2013-02-05
grischka
tests: cleanup
commit
|
commitdiff
|
tree
2013-02-05
g
rischka
tes
t
s2
:
mo
v
e
i
nto tes
t
s
commit
|
commitdiff
|
tree
2013-02-04
grischka
portability: make
tcc_g
e
t_symb
o
l()
a
vailable
for n
o
n
.
.
.
commit
|
commitdiff
|
tree
2013-02-04
gris
c
hk
a
win32: Honor "-Wl,-subsyst
e
m=console/gui
"
option
commit
|
commitdiff
|
tree
2013-02-04
grischka
t
c
crun
.
c: unify
r
t_get_caller_pc pr
o
totyp
e
commit
|
commitdiff
|
tree
2013-02-04
gr
i
sch
k
a
M
akef
i
le: fix "
a
llow CO
N
FIG_LDDIR=l
i
b
64 c
o
nfiguration"
commit
|
commitdiff
|
tree
2013-02-04
grischka
portability: fix void* <->
t
arget address
c
onversion
.
.
.
commit
|
commitdiff
|
tree
2013-02-04
grisc
h
ka
Makefile: al
l
o
w
CO
N
FIG_LDDIR=lib64 c
o
nfigura
t
ion
commit
|
commitdiff
|
tree
2013-02-04
grischka
win3
2
: wincrt1
.
c: include stdlib
.
h
f
or exi
t
()
commit
|
commitdiff
|
tree
2013-02-04
grischk
a
c67: remov
e
global #
d
e
f
ine's f
o
r T
R
UE/FALSE/BOOL
commit
|
commitdiff
|
tree
2013-01-31
g
r
ischka
s
a
f
ety:
replace occurrences of strcpy by pstrcpy
commit
|
commitdiff
|
tree
2013-01-30
g
ris
c
h
k
a
Chang
e
log:
c
leanup
commit
|
commitdiff
|
tree
2013-01-30
gri
s
chka
a
rm
:
d
ef
i
ne TCC_ARM_VE
R
S
I
O
N
for
c
r
oss
compiler
commit
|
commitdiff
|
tree
2013-01-30
gri
s
chk
a
tccpe: no deb
u
g, no stabs
commit
|
commitdiff
|
tree
2013-01-30
grischka
config
u
re: use re
l
ative paths for in-tree
build
commit
|
commitdiff
|
tree
2013-01-24
grischka
win
3
2: _
m
i
ngw
.
h:
d
o
n
ot undef NU
L
L
commit
|
commitdiff
|
tree
2013-01-14
grischka
Reve
r
t "
O
ptimiz
e
vs
w
ap()"
commit
|
commitdiff
|
tree
2013-01-14
grischka
Revert mis
t
ake
i
n "win
3
2: malloc
.
h:
fix win32
.
.
.
_S
T
ATIC_AS
.
.
.
commit
|
commitdiff
|
tree
next